William Faherty (United States, 1910s)

This studio portrait is of William Faherty who was called Bill. There is no other information on the portrait. Bill looks to be about 12 years old. He wears a formal Eton collar and a knickers suit with long stockings for the porrait. The suit was probably navy blue. The suit was a very popular style for a boy's best suit. The Eton collar was more populsr in Englsnd than Amerrica. Not all boys wore Eton collars with these suits, but we see quite a few boys with these collars. Eton collars were more popular with conservsative, well to do families. The portrait is not dated, but looks to have been taken in the 1910s. The studio was M. Konrad, 4-2 W. 125th St New York City. The photo is done in a paper mount with a tissue overlay.
